Computer Science: The Foundation for a Sustainable Future

Introduction

Computer Science represents the systematic study of algorithmic processes, computational machines, and computation itself. As a discipline, it has evolved from theoretical foundations to become the bedrock of modern technological advancement, driving innovation across every sector of society. From artificial intelligence to cloud computing, computer science principles enable the digital transformation that characterizes our contemporary world. Its relevance extends beyond technical domains, influencing economics, healthcare, education, and environmental sustainability through data-driven solutions and automated systems.

Environmental, Social, and Governance (ESG) criteria have emerged as a critical framework for evaluating organizational performance beyond financial metrics. ESG represents a holistic approach to sustainable development that considers environmental impact, social responsibility, and ethical governance practices. In Singapore, the demand for has surged by 47% over the past two years, reflecting growing recognition of its importance among businesses and investors alike. This certification process validates an organization's commitment to sustainable practices and responsible operations.

The central thesis of this discussion posits that computer science serves as an indispensable enabler for achieving ESG objectives. Through computational technologies, data analytics, and innovative software solutions, computer science provides the tools necessary to address complex sustainability challenges. Understanding in the context of ESG reveals its transformative potential—not merely as a technical field but as a catalyst for positive environmental and social change.

How Computer Science Contributes to Environmental Sustainability

Smart Grids and Energy Efficiency

Computer science fundamentally transforms energy management through the development and optimization of smart grids. These intelligent electricity networks leverage computational systems to monitor, control, and analyze energy flow in real-time, creating responsive and efficient power distribution. Advanced algorithms process vast streams of data from smart meters, weather stations, and consumption patterns to predict energy demand with remarkable accuracy. Machine learning models can forecast peak usage periods days in advance, allowing utilities to optimize generation and distribution, thereby reducing waste and preventing overloads.

In Hong Kong, implementation of smart grid technologies has yielded impressive results:

  • 15% reduction in transmission and distribution losses
  • 22% improvement in outage management response times
  • 8% overall decrease in energy consumption during peak periods

These systems employ sophisticated optimization algorithms that balance supply and demand dynamically, incorporating renewable energy sources seamlessly. Computer scientists develop distributed computing architectures that enable real-time pricing models, encouraging consumers to shift usage to off-peak hours. The integration of Internet of Things (IoT) devices with energy infrastructure creates a responsive ecosystem where appliances, electric vehicles, and storage systems communicate to maximize efficiency while minimizing environmental impact.

Environmental Monitoring and Data Analysis

Computer science enables unprecedented capabilities in environmental monitoring through networks of sensors, satellites, and data collection systems. These technologies generate terabytes of ecological data daily, requiring advanced computational methods for meaningful analysis. Sensor networks deployed across Singapore's urban landscape track air quality indicators, water pollution levels, and noise pollution in real-time, creating comprehensive environmental maps that inform policy decisions.

Artificial intelligence has revolutionized environmental modeling and prediction. Machine learning algorithms process historical climate data to identify patterns and project future scenarios with increasing accuracy. Deep learning models analyze satellite imagery to detect deforestation, monitor glacial retreat, and track urban expansion. In Hong Kong, AI-powered systems analyzing harbor water quality have achieved 94% accuracy in predicting red tide events up to 72 hours in advance, enabling preventive measures that protect marine ecosystems.

Computer vision techniques applied to drone-captured imagery can identify illegal dumping sites, monitor wildlife populations, and assess the health of coral reefs. Natural language processing algorithms scan scientific literature, social media, and news reports to identify emerging environmental threats. These computational approaches transform raw environmental data into actionable intelligence, empowering conservation efforts and sustainable resource management.

Green Computing and Sustainable Software Development

The field of computer science is increasingly focused on reducing its own environmental footprint through green computing initiatives. This encompasses both hardware efficiency improvements and sustainable software development practices. Energy-efficient coding techniques minimize computational resources required for program execution, while optimized algorithms reduce processing time and power consumption.

Sustainable software development principles include:

Practice Environmental Benefit Implementation Example
Algorithmic efficiency Reduces CPU cycles and energy consumption Using O(n log n) instead of O(n²) sorting algorithms
Resource-aware programming Minimizes memory and storage requirements Implementing lazy loading for large datasets
Cloud optimization Leverages scalable resources efficiently Auto-scaling based on actual workload demands
Data center efficiency Reduces cooling and power requirements Implementing hot/cold aisle containment systems

In Singapore, data centers implementing green computing practices have achieved Power Usage Effectiveness (PUE) ratings as low as 1.3, significantly below the industry average of 1.8. Sustainable data storage strategies, including data deduplication, compression, and tiered storage architectures, reduce the physical infrastructure required for information retention. The principles of green computing extend beyond technical optimization to include the entire lifecycle of digital products, from energy-efficient design to responsible electronic waste management.

Computer Science and Social Responsibility

Accessibility and Inclusivity

Computer science drives the development of technologies that empower people with disabilities, creating more inclusive digital environments. Through specialized algorithms and interface designs, computer scientists build systems that adapt to diverse user needs and abilities. Screen readers powered by text-to-speech algorithms, voice recognition systems for hands-free interaction, and eye-tracking interfaces for users with limited mobility represent just a few examples of how computation enhances accessibility.

Inclusive design principles are being integrated throughout the software development lifecycle, ensuring that digital products serve the broadest possible audience. Computer vision algorithms can automatically generate alt-text for images, benefiting users with visual impairments. Natural language processing enables real-time captioning services for deaf and hard-of-hearing individuals. Hong Kong's public sector websites have seen a 67% improvement in accessibility compliance since adopting automated testing tools that identify interface barriers during development.

The social impact of accessible technology extends beyond individual convenience to broader societal participation. When digital platforms accommodate diverse abilities, they enable equal access to education, employment, healthcare, and social connections. Computer scientists bear ethical responsibility for considering accessibility not as an afterthought but as a fundamental requirement in system design, recognizing that technology should bridge rather than widen social divides.

Addressing Bias in AI

As artificial intelligence systems increasingly influence critical decisions in hiring, lending, and criminal justice, computer science confronts the ethical challenge of algorithmic bias. AI systems trained on historical data can perpetuate and even amplify existing societal prejudices, creating discriminatory outcomes. Facial recognition technologies have demonstrated significant racial and gender bias, while resume screening algorithms have been found to disadvantage qualified candidates from underrepresented groups.

Computer scientists are developing sophisticated techniques to detect, measure, and mitigate bias in machine learning models:

  • Adversarial debiasing: Using competing neural networks to identify and remove biased patterns
  • Fairness constraints: Incorporating mathematical fairness metrics directly into optimization objectives
  • Causal modeling: Understanding the root causes of bias rather than just correlational patterns
  • Diverse training data: Ensuring representative datasets that reflect real-world diversity

In Singapore, financial institutions implementing bias detection frameworks have reduced demographic disparities in credit scoring by 38% while maintaining predictive accuracy. The field of algorithmic fairness has emerged as a specialized intersection of computer science and ethics, developing quantitative methods to ensure equitable treatment across population subgroups. These technical approaches must be complemented by diverse development teams and inclusive design processes that identify potential biases before they become embedded in systems.

Cybersecurity and Data Privacy

Computer science provides the foundational technologies for protecting personal data and privacy in an increasingly connected world. Cryptographic algorithms secure digital communications, while access control systems ensure that sensitive information remains available only to authorized individuals. The development of privacy-preserving computation techniques, including homomorphic encryption and differential privacy, enables data analysis without exposing underlying personal information.

In Hong Kong, reported data breaches increased by 27% in 2022, highlighting the growing importance of robust cybersecurity measures. Computer scientists develop intrusion detection systems that use machine learning to identify anomalous patterns indicative of security threats. Blockchain technologies create tamper-resistant audit trails for sensitive transactions, while zero-knowledge proofs enable identity verification without disclosing unnecessary personal details.

The ethical dimensions of data security extend beyond technical protection to questions of appropriate use and consent. Computer scientists must balance security imperatives with privacy rights, developing systems that are both secure and respectful of individual autonomy. This includes designing transparent data practices, implementing privacy-by-design architectures, and creating tools that give users meaningful control over their digital footprints.

Governance and Computer Science

Transparency and Accountability

Computer science technologies are transforming governance by enabling unprecedented levels of transparency and accountability in public and corporate decision-making. Open data platforms make government information accessible to citizens, while data visualization tools help communicate complex policy decisions in understandable formats. In Singapore, the implementation of public-facing data portals correlated with a 31% increase in citizen engagement with policy development processes.

Blockchain technology offers particularly promising applications for transparent governance through its immutable, distributed ledger capabilities. Smart contracts automate compliance verification while creating permanent, auditable records of transactions. Supply chain management systems built on blockchain provide transparent tracking of goods from origin to consumer, addressing concerns about ethical sourcing and environmental impact. This technology proves especially valuable in , where transparent budgeting and vendor selection processes build stakeholder trust.

Algorithmic accountability frameworks represent another computer science contribution to governance transparency. These systems document the decision logic of automated systems, enabling audits to detect biased or erroneous outcomes. Explainable AI techniques help stakeholders understand how complex models reach conclusions, moving beyond "black box" systems whose operations remain opaque even to their creators. When implementing digital governance solutions, organizations pursuing esg certification singapore often prioritize these transparency-enhancing technologies to demonstrate their commitment to ethical operations.

Data-Driven Policy Making

Computer science enables evidence-based governance through advanced data analytics that inform policy development and evaluation. Predictive models simulate policy impacts before implementation, allowing governments to anticipate unintended consequences and optimize outcomes. Natural language processing algorithms analyze public sentiment from social media, news coverage, and citizen feedback, providing real-time insight into community needs and concerns.

In Hong Kong, data-driven approaches to urban planning have yielded significant improvements:

Policy Area Data-Driven Approach Measured Outcome
Transportation Traffic flow optimization using IoT sensors 18% reduction in average commute times
Healthcare Predictive modeling for disease outbreaks 42% faster response to emerging health threats
Education Learning analytics identifying at-risk students 23% improvement in intervention effectiveness

Despite these opportunities, data-driven governance presents significant challenges regarding data quality, algorithmic fairness, and privacy protection. Computer scientists develop techniques to address these concerns, including federated learning approaches that analyze distributed data without centralization, and synthetic data generation that preserves statistical patterns while protecting individual privacy. The responsible implementation of data-driven policy requires continuous evaluation and adjustment, with computer science providing both the tools for analysis and the frameworks for ethical application.

Synthesis and Forward Perspective

The intersection of computer science and ESG represents a powerful synergy with transformative potential. Computational technologies provide the means to measure, analyze, and address complex sustainability challenges that would otherwise remain intractable. From optimizing energy systems to detecting algorithmic bias, computer science delivers both the diagnostic tools to understand problems and the intervention tools to solve them.

The integration of ESG principles into computer science education and practice is essential for maximizing this potential. Academic programs must evolve beyond technical proficiency to include ethical reasoning, environmental awareness, and social impact assessment. Professional development should emphasize the broader consequences of technological decisions, preparing computer scientists to recognize and address the unintended impacts of their work.

A call to action emerges for computer scientists to embrace their role as stewards of a sustainable future. This requires prioritizing environmental and social considerations alongside technical excellence, recognizing that the most elegant algorithm holds limited value if it exacerbates inequality or environmental degradation. The question of what is computer science must expand to encompass not just what computations are possible, but which computations are beneficial for people and the planet.

The growing demand for esg certification singapore reflects market recognition that sustainable practices correlate with long-term value creation. Computer scientists have unique opportunity—and responsibility—to build the technological foundations for this sustainable future. Through intentional design, ethical implementation, and continuous refinement, computational systems can accelerate progress toward environmental stewardship, social equity, and transparent governance worldwide.